打开APP
userphoto
未登录

开通VIP,畅享免费电子书等14项超值服

开通VIP
【Excel函数与公式】DATE函数的用法解析

Excel 中的DATE公式解析

DATE函数定义:使用年、月、日三个值来构造日期

函数语法:

=DATE(year,month,day)
  • year 为必需参数。year 参数 的值可以包含 1 到 4 个数字。Excel 根据 计算机使用 的日期系统解释 year 参数。默认情况下,Microsoft Excel for Windows 使用 1900 日期系统,这意味着第一个日期是 1900 年 1 月 1 日。

如果 year 介于 0(零)到 1899 之间(包含这两个值),则 Excel 会将该值与 1900 相加来计算年份。例如,DATE(108,1,2) 返回 2008 年 1 月 2 日 (1900+108)。

如果 year 介于 1900 到 9999 之间(包含这两个值),则 Excel 将使用该数值作为年份。例如,DATE(2008,1,2)返回 2008 年 1 月 2 日。

如果 year 小于 0 或大于 10000,Excel 将返回#NUM! 错误值。

  • Month 必需参数。一个正整数或负整数,表示一年中从 1 月至 12 月(一月到十二月)的各个月。

如果 month 大于 12,则 month 会从指定年份的第一个月开始加上该月份数。例如,DATE(2008,14,2) 返回表示 2009 年 2 月 2 日的序列数。

如果 month 小于 1,则 month 会从指定年份的第一个月开始减去该月份数,然后再加上 1 个月。例如,DATE(2008,-3,2)返回表示 2007 年 9 月 2 日的序列号。

  • Day 必需参数。一个正整数或负整数,表示一月中从 1 日到 31 日的各天。

如果 day 大于指定月中的天数,则 day 会从该月的第一天开始加上该天数。例如,DATE(2008,1,35) 返回表示 2008 年 2 月 4 日的序列数。

如果 day 小于 1,则 day 从指定月份的第一天开始减去该天数,然后再加上 1 天。例如,DATE(2008,1,-15) 返回表示 2007 年 12 月 16 日的序列号。

示例1:直接引用数值

=DATE(1999,1,1) // 返回 1999年1月1日
=DATE(2021,6,1) // 返回 2021年6月1日
1

示例2::单元格引用数值

=DATE(A1,4,15) // 返回2021年4月15日
2

示例3:与Sumifs、Countifs嵌套使用

=COUNTIF(A3:A16,">"&DATE(A1,B1,C1))
3

示例4:计算今年任意月份的天数,如2月

=DAY(DATE(YEAR(TODAY()),3,1)-1) 
//1、首先获取到今年3月1日的日期,减去1,即2月最后1天的日期
//2、再使用DAY函数提取日期中的天,即得到2月的天数
4

今天和大家介绍了Excel中DATE函数的用法,大家都学会了吗?

欢迎大家关注:Python编程与Office办公自动化!

本站仅提供存储服务,所有内容均由用户发布,如发现有害或侵权内容,请点击举报
打开APP,阅读全文并永久保存 查看更多类似文章
猜你喜欢
类似文章
【热】打开小程序,算一算2024你的财运
excel day函数用法及实例
Excel函数学习44:DATE函数
记住43个Excel函数的用法,掌握数据分析 ( 五 )
精华区
如何计算?——“隐形”函数Datedif
excel中如何计算两个日期之间工作日的天数
更多类似文章 >>
生活服务
热点新闻
分享 收藏 导长图 关注 下载文章
绑定账号成功
后续可登录账号畅享VIP特权!
如果VIP功能使用有故障,
可点击这里联系客服!

联系客服